| As children adjust to the three-year old preschool experience, a major focus is on fostering developmental milestones. Literature, seasonal themes, scientific exploration, art, cooperative play, and development of oral communication are all emphasized. |

Our son, however, started off the year without any trouble, thanks to [his teacher], and he has had a marvelous time this entire year.” – Sarah and Aaron, parents In accordance with State of Ohio regulations this class has a maximum of 12 students. With a teacher and two parent helpers in the class we provide an exceptional number of adults per children. This class meets for two and a half hours two times a week. Children who are at least 3 years old by September 30th and are fully toilet trained are eligible for this class. |

Sample 3’s Class Schedule Class times may vary; contact an enrollment coordinator for information on our current offerings. 9:00-9:10 Arrival: Welcome! Greet your teacher and your friends. Table games open. 9:10-9:20 Small Circle: Discuss the calendar, weather, etc. and talk about our plans for the day. 9:20-9:30 Music/Movement: Get Moving! 9:30-10:30 Free Play: Choose activities from the open centers to explore and learn. (blocks, housekeeping,sand/water table, art, books,science center, etc.) 10:30 Clean Up: Toys away, toys away, time to put our toys away. 10:35-10:55 Big Circle: Stories, finger-plays and other fun! 10:55 Bathroom/Handwashing: Count to 15 while you wash! 11:00-11:10 Snack: Enjoy a healthy treat. 11:10-11:30 Large Muscle Time: Play outdoors or in the gym. 11:30 Dismissal: Say goodbye to your teacher and your friends.
